Josh Hamilton Has 4-Homer Game in Baltimore: Texas Rangers outfielder Josh Hamilton hit four home runs Tuesday night against the Baltimore Orioles, going 5-for-5 with 8 RBI (the fifth hit was a double). Hamilton becomes the 16th player in big league history to hit four homers in a game and the first since Carlos Delgado in 2003.
